The Psychiatric Rehabilitation Worker will provide Personal and Community Integration services. Personal and Community Integration Services- Using rehabilitation interventions and individualized, collaborative, hands-on training to build developmentally appropriate skills. The intent is to promote personal independence, autonomy, and mutual supports by developing and strengthening the individual’s independent community living skills and support community integration in the domains of employment, housing, education, in both personal and community life.
